Peter Diary by GrowTricity is a simple mobile booking, sale parchi, paid/pending and cash-book diary for salons, beauty parlours, nail studios and car-service shops in Tricity (Mohali, Chandigarh, Panchkula, Zirakpur, Kharar, Dera Bassi).
30 days free. First 50 shops: Rs 99/month. Regular price: Rs 399/month. No card needed to try.

Yes. Salons, beauty parlours, nail studios and car service workshops can save bookings, make a sale parchi or job card, record paid and pending balance, and open a WhatsApp parchi the owner sends manually.
Make the sale parchi, then tap Open WhatsApp parchi. Peter fills the bill, paid and pending amounts — you check it and send the parchi to the customer yourself. Peter never sends WhatsApp automatically.
Yes. The cash book shows opening balance, cash sales, expenses (kharcha) and cash taken home, then the closing balance. Today's closing carries to tomorrow's opening, just like a paper rokad bahi.

Yes, a simpler owner-led one. Peter Diary focuses on booking, sale parchi, paid/pending and a daily cash book — it is not GST billing, udhaar recovery or full accounting.
Yes. A car service shop makes a job card for each vehicle — services, final bill and paid/pending — then opens a WhatsApp parchi for the customer.
No. Peter Diary opens in your web browser on any phone or computer — nothing to install from the Play Store or App Store, and no credit card to start.
Yes. The same diary works on your phone and your desktop or laptop — just open it in any browser. Owner and front desk can use it on different devices.
Yes. Peter shows each staff member's work and value for the day, so you can see who is performing and who is bringing in more business.
